Welcome Home Mission
SGT Shane Parsons
Fostoria, Ohio

WOUNDED IN ACTION
Ramadi, Iraq
30 September 2006
Staging Location:
1754 North Union Street
Fostoria, Ohio
05 November 2009@1515hrs-(3:15PM)
District #1 Ride Captain Jon Williams is assigned this Welcome Home Mission. Please follow his instructions and remember to bring your 3x5 American Flags. In the event of inclement weather come in you’re cage.
As most of you know when Shane was injured he was a Corporal in the US Army, he has since been promoted to Sergeant. He was released from Active duty this past week and is returning home. Since September 30 2006 Shane has went through a lot of rehabilitation and his now returning to Civilian life. As the picture above show from that first Christmas at home after there new home was completed Shane and his mother “Cindy” are truly a “SPECIAL TEAM together against the world” as Cindy had told the Stars & Strips in a recent article.
There were several organizations involved in making their new home a reality and the Patriot Guard Riders played a small part in making that happen. Now, as Shane makes the transition into civilian life we need to be there when needed for him and his mother. I want them to know they are not alone together against the world. We the Patriot Guard Riders will be there for them.
To Cindy and Shane, thank you so much for letting us show our appreciation for serving our country and letting us be a part of your lives.
Bob Woods
Ohio State Captain
